What you’ll do in this role:

  • Organizes assigned workload to facilitate its accomplishment.

  • Completes batch records and other pharmacy records as indicated.

  • Verifies completed batch records against the computer record.

  • Generates labels and picks and packages prepackaged and unit dose drugs in accordance with the dispensing order (pick-list) and under the supervision of a pharmacist.

  • Participates with the pharmacist and materials management coordinator in monitoring/maintaining drug inventories and preparing orders for drugs and related supplies.

  • Answers the telephone and takes messages as indicated.

  • Participates in department QA activities as requested.

  • Attends designated departmental meetings as scheduled.

We are looking for a compassionate Processing/Filling Technician with:

  • Pharmacy Technician License

  • Minimum two years pharmacy experience preferred

  • High School diploma.

  • Successful completing of an approved/accredited pharmacy technician training program desirable

  • Minimum of one year's experience in the aseptic preparation of large/small volume parenteral, parenteral nutrition, antibiotics and chemotherapy.

  • Knowledge of basic drug terminology, pharmaceutical calculations, drug use and aseptic technique.
